WebHTTP (S) load-balancing services are Layer 7 load balancers that only accept HTTP (S) traffic. They are intended for web applications or other HTTP (S) endpoints. They include features such as SSL offload, web application firewall, path-based load balancing, and session affinity. Web9 aug. 2024 · The diagram above shows a Network Load Balancer in front of the Ingress resource. This load balancer will route traffic to a Kubernetes service (or Ingress) on your cluster that will perform service-specific routing. NLB with the Ingress definition provides the benefits of both a NLB and an Ingress resource. WebOpenELB is an open-source load balancer implementation designed for exposing the LoadBalancer type of Kubernetes services in bare metal, edge, and virtualization environments. OpenELB was originally created by KubeSphere and is currently a vendor neutral and CNCF Sandbox Project. Why OpenELB
